Add 60/98 and 40/9
1st number: 60/98, 2nd number: 4 4/9
60/98 + 40/9 is 2230/441.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 98 and 9 is 882
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 882 - For the 1st fraction, since 98 × 9 = 882,
60/98 = 60 × 9/98 × 9 = 540/882 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 9 × 98 = 882,
40/9 = 40 × 98/9 × 98 = 3920/882 - Add the two like fractions:
540/882 + 3920/882 = 540 + 3920/882 = 4460/882 - 4460/882 simplified gives 2230/441
- So, 60/98 + 40/9 = 2230/441
